ROUNDUP Liberty defeats Newton Falls
Laura Kellow, Ami Markowitz and Sunny Smallwood ignited the Leopards to their sixth win.
YOUNGSTOWN -- Laura Kellow had five kills and Ami Markowitz added four more, as the Liberty High volleyball team defeated Newton Falls 15-10, 20-18 in Trumbull Athletic Conference action Thursday.
Sunny Smallwood was in with 11 points for the Leopards (6-10, 3-9).
For the Tigers (4-11, 3-10), Ashley Shaver assisted 12 times and Lora Mason had eight kills.
